Hi there, I'm Julia! Hi, I'm Julia McCoy, a licensed therapist with over ten years of experience working with couples, families, and individuals. I hold a Master’s degree in Marriage and Family Therapy from Capella University. I take a holistic, collaborative, and respectful approach, helping clients navigate life’s challenges, improve relationships, and achieve personal growth. My practice focuses on fostering healing and empowerment, guiding clients toward meaningful change and greater well-being. My approach My therapeutic approach is eclectic, drawing from client-centered, narrative, d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), and c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) modalities. I tailor each session to meet the unique needs of my clients, fostering a compassionate and nonjudgmental space where they feel heard and empowered. By integrating various techniques, I help clients explore their personal stories, develop coping skills, challenge unhelpful thought patterns, and build meaningful, lasting change. My focus I work with individuals, couples, and families navigating a variety of life challenges. I am most comfortable treating anxiety, depression, relationship issues, life transitions, and emotional regulation difficulties. I also support clients in building self-esteem, managing stress, and processing past experiences, tailoring my approach to meet each person’s unique needs and goals. My communication style In sessions, I create a direct and supportive environment where honesty and clarity are key. I’m assertive and straightforward, helping clients face challenges head-on without beating around the bush. While I approach conversations with empathy and respect, I believe in addressing issues openly to foster meaningful growth and lasting change. Working with me feels like having a trusted partner who encourages accountability and empowers you to make real progress.
